1. A method of operating a first peer communications device to communicate with a second peer communications device, in a system supporting multiple peer to peer connections, the method comprising:

  • monitoring, by the first peer communications device, a connection identifier broadcast interval to identify unused connection identifiers of a set of connection identifiers associated with one or more symbols and tones for peer to peer connections, each connection identifier in the set of connection identifiers for identifying a peer to peer connection between the first and the second peer communications devices;

    transmitting, by the first peer communications device, a set of available and unused connection identifiers from the identified unused connection identifiers for peer to peer connections to the second peer communications device; and

    receiving, by the first peer communications device, from the second peer communications device a subset of said transmitted set of available and unused connection identifiers, said subset of connection identifiers including identifiers to be used for peer to peer connection between said first and second peer communications devices.
